要以编程方式选择JQGrid的顶行,您可以使用以下方法:
setSelection
方法:$("#grid").setSelection(rowid, onSelectRowEvent);
其中,rowid
是要选择的行的ID,onSelectRowEvent
是一个可选参数,表示在选择行时要执行的回调函数。
resetSelection
方法:$("#grid").resetSelection(rowid);
其中,rowid
是要取消选择的行的ID。
getGridParam
和setGridParam
方法:// 获取选中行的ID
var selRowId = $("#grid").getGridParam("selrow");
// 设置选中行的ID
$("#grid").setGridParam({ selrow: rowid });
其中,selRowId
是选中行的ID,rowid
是要选择的行的ID。
请注意,在使用这些方法之前,您需要确保JQGrid已经初始化完成,并且已经加载了数据。您可以在loadComplete
事件处理程序中执行这些方法。
例如:
$("#grid").jqGrid({
// 其他选项
loadComplete: function() {
// 在这里执行选择行的代码
}
});
希望这些信息对您有所帮助!如果您有其他问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云